Officer Lawrence L. Dorsey
Metropolitan Police Department
District of Columbia

End of Watch: Friday, February 2, 1968

Biographical Info
Age: 28
Tour of Duty: 5 years
Badge Number: Not available

Incident Details
Cause of Death: Gunfire
Date of Incident: Wednesday, January 31, 1968
Weapon Used: Shotgun
Suspect Info: Not available

Officer Dorsey was shot and killed while responding to a man with a gun call on 62nd Street, NE. When he arrived he discovered a man with a shotgun. He ordered the man to drop the gun and as he attempted to arrest him a struggle ensued. The man fired the shotgun twice, striking Officer Dorsey both times. Officer Dorsey succumbed to his wounds two days later.

Officer Dorsey had been with the agency for 5 years. He was survived by his wife and two sons.
